Vegan Oil Free Zucchini Fritters

Prep Time: 10 mins
Cook Time: 15 mins
Total Time: 25 mins
Cuisine: Vegan
Serves: 4 servings

Ingredients

  1. 2 medium zucchinis, grated
  2. 1/2 cup chickpea flour
  3. 1/4 cup nutritional yeast
  4. 1 teaspoon onion powder
  5. 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  6. Salt and pepper to taste
  7. Fresh herbs (optional)

Instructions

  1. Grate the zucchinis using a box grater or food processor, ensuring you use the medium-sized holes for consistent texture.
  2. Place the grated zucchini in a clean kitchen towel and squeeze out excess moisture thoroughly. This step is crucial to prevent soggy fritters.
  3. In a large mixing bowl, combine the squeezed zucchini, chickpea flour, nutritional yeast, onion powder,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Mix ingredients until well incorporated.
  4. If using fresh herbs like chopped parsley or dill, fold them into the mixture for additional flavor.
  5. Preheat a non-stick skillet or well-seasoned cast-iron pan over medium heat. No oil is needed due to the non-stick surface.
  6. Using a 1/4 cup measure, scoop the zucchini mixture and drop onto the heated pan, gently pressing each fritter to create a flat circular shape.
  7. Cook each fritter for approximately 3-4 minutes on each side, or until golden brown and crispy edges form.
  8. Transfer cooked fritters to a wire rack to maintain crispness and prevent steaming.
  9. Serve immediately with optional accompaniments like vegan yogurt, herb sauce, or fresh lemon wedges.

Tips

  1. Moisture is the Enemy: Always squeeze out excess water from grated zucchini using a clean kitchen towel. This is the secret to achieving crispy, not soggy fritters.
  2. Consistent Size Matters: Use a 1/4 cup measure to ensure uniform fritters that cook evenly and look professionally made.
  3. Heat Control is Key: Cook on medium heat to achieve that perfect golden-brown exterior without burning.
  4. Don't Overcrowd the Pan: Cook fritters in batches to maintain the right temperature and ensure crispy edges.
  5. Herb Variations: Experiment with different fresh herbs like dill, parsley, or chives to customize the flavor profile.
  6. Serving Suggestions: Pair with vegan yogurt, a zesty herb sauce, or a squeeze of fresh lemon for an extra flavor boost.
  7. Make-Ahead Tip: While best served immediately, you can keep fritters warm in a low-temperature oven for short periods without losing crispness.

Nutrition Facts

Calories: 86kcal

Carbohydrates: 14g

Protein: 6g

Fat: 1g

Saturated Fat: 0g

Cholesterol: 0mg
